Fix messageset conformance for pure Python to match Py-C++ and Py-upb
MessageSet is a legacy affordance holdover from pre-proto2 days. Unlike the rest of Protobuf, it has first-wins instead of last-wins semantic in the case of duplicate ids or values within the same message set entry. No serializer would ever write such sequences, but the same hypothetical byte sequence being parsed differently by two implementations is undesirable. Note that other nonconformance fixes would commonly be held to breaking change releases to avoid any possible disruption of single-language users who may be relying on it as a load-bearing bug. However, the nature of this particular case is such that there is little reason to hold it back. PiperOrigin-RevId: 964043226
